32

私はカサンドラが初めてです。ここに と の 2 つのテーブルがEVENTSありTOWERます。いくつかのクエリのためにそれらに参加する必要があります。しかし、私はそれを行うことができません。

EVENTSテーブルの構造:

eid int PRIMARY KEY,
a_end_tow_id text,
a_home_circle text,
a_home_operator text,
a_imei text,
a_imsi text,

TOWERテーブルの構造:

 tid int PRIMARY KEY,
 tower_address_1 text,
 tower_address_2 text,
 tower_azimuth text,
 tower_cgi text,
 tower_circle text,
 tower_id_no text,
 tower_lat_d text,
 tower_long_d text,
 tower_name text,

EIDここで、これらのテーブルをandに関して結合してTID、両方のテーブルのデータを取得できるようにします。

4

3 に答える 3

7

Cassandra でテーブルを結合してクエリを実行するには、いくつかの方法があります。しかし、もちろん、データ モデルの部分を再考する必要があります。

  1. Apache Spark の SparkSQL ™を Cassandra (オープン ソースまたは DataStax Enterprise – DSE) で使用します。
  2. Cassandra および DSE でDataStax が提供する ODBCコネクターを使用します。
于 2015-06-23T05:40:29.513 に答える